溫馨提示×

Python怎么創(chuàng)建Dataframe數(shù)據(jù)框

小億
101
2024-01-26 15:39:35
欄目: 編程語言

有多種方法可以創(chuàng)建DataFrame數(shù)據(jù)框,以下是一些常見的方法:

  1. 從列表或數(shù)組創(chuàng)建DataFrame:
import pandas as pd

data = [['Alice', 25], ['Bob', 30], ['Charlie', 35]]
df = pd.DataFrame(data, columns=['Name', 'Age'])
  1. 從字典創(chuàng)建DataFrame:
import pandas as pd

data = {'Name': ['Alice', 'Bob', 'Charlie'], 'Age': [25, 30, 35]}
df = pd.DataFrame(data)
  1. 從CSV文件創(chuàng)建DataFrame:
import pandas as pd

df = pd.read_csv('data.csv')
  1. 從Excel文件創(chuàng)建DataFrame:
import pandas as pd

df = pd.read_excel('data.xlsx')
  1. 從SQL數(shù)據(jù)庫查詢結果創(chuàng)建DataFrame:
import pandas as pd
import sqlite3

conn = sqlite3.connect('database.db')
query = 'SELECT * FROM table_name'
df = pd.read_sql(query, conn)

這些方法只是創(chuàng)建DataFrame的一些例子,根據(jù)具體的數(shù)據(jù)源和需求,可能有更多的方法來創(chuàng)建DataFrame。

0